Exports In 2022, Burundi exported $503 in Cotton Waste, making it the 112th largest exporter of Cotton Waste in the world. At the same year, Cotton Waste was the 343rd most exported product in Burundi. The main destination of Cotton Waste exports from Burundi are: Kenya ($442) and Democratic Republic of the Congo ($61).

The fastest growing export markets for Cotton Waste of Burundi between 2021 and 2022 were Kenya ($442).

Imports In 2022, Burundi imported $2.51k in Cotton Waste, becoming the 139th largest importer of Cotton Waste in the world. At the same year, Cotton Waste was the 841st most imported product in Burundi. Burundi imports Cotton Waste primarily from: Tanzania ($2.51k).

The fastest growing import markets in Cotton Waste for Burundi between 2021 and 2022 were Tanzania ($1.92k).
